Welcome Activity Place the Bow Place the Bow is an activity that that uses fine motor skills to introduce today s Bible story. What You Need: Large bag of ready-stick gift bows, large empty box, Christmas wrapping paper, clear tape, and scissors What You Do: Before the Activity: Wrap the box in the Christmas wrapping paper. Do not place any bows on the box. During the Activity: Place the wrapped box in the center of the activity area. Place the bows near the box. Encourage the children to stick all of the bows onto the wrapped box. After the Activity: Introduce the Bible story. What You Say: Before the Activity: There s a gift in our class today. (Point.) Hmm... but it seems to be missing something. It s missing Christmas bows! During the Activity Here are some bows that we can put on the gift. (Point.) Can you help me put on the bows? (Pause.) You re doing a great job! 2011 Orange. All rights reserved. 15
3 After the Activity: That looks fantastic! It s fun to give gifts at Christmas. Today in our Bible story we will hear about some shepherds who got a message about a very SPECIAL gift! I cannot wait for you to find out what it was! 5 Make It Stick-(Craft) The following activity is designed to help make the Bottom Line stick. Craft/Activity In Order In Order is an activity that reviews this month s Bible stories while teaching the children sequencing and critical thinking skills. What You Need: Story Cards Activity Pages and white cardstock What You Do: ***Attention Craft Team- No craft Prep!!!!!! During the Activity: Retell all of the stories from this month. Then ask the children to help you put the pictures in order as they happened in the story. After the Activity: Ask the children the Key Question for this month and say the Bottom Line together. What You Say: Before the Activity: All of our stories this month have been AMAZING! Our stories are what we call the Christmas story, which is one of my favorite stories! During the Activity: An angel came to visit a young girl named Mary. He told her that she would have a very special baby named Jesus. [Bottom Line] Jesus is God s Son! Mary and her husband Joseph had to take a trip. After the trip Mary was VERY tired. Joseph tried to find them a room, but they were all FULL! So they found a stable where animals lived to stay in and Jesus was born in the stable. Nearby in some fields, shepherds were watching their sheep when the sky became full of LIGHT! There were ANGELS! The angels came to tell them that God gave us the GREATEST gift of all: JESUS! These pictures are of our stories. Please tell me what you remember about the stories. Let s start with the picture of Mary and the angel first! Can you tell me what you remember about this story? Which picture is next? (Pause.) You got it! Jesus was born in the stable. Let s talk about what happened in that story. And the final picture is when the angels and the shepherds. (Hold up.) Tell me what happened when the shepherds saw the angels. After the Activity: I LOVE the Christmas story. I am so glad God gave us Jesus. Why is Jesus special? [Bottom Line] Jesus is God s Son! 2011 Orange. All rights reserved. 18

Dismissal- Loud or Soft Loud or Soft is an activity that allows the children to be the ones that deliver the message just like the angels did in the Bible story. What You Need: No supplies needed What You Do: Before the Activity: Have the children stand in front of you. Say the memory verse as a class. During the Activity: Say the verse several more times. Challenge the children to say the verse very softly, then loudly, and then VERY loudly. Repeat as desired. After the Activity: Say the Bottom Line together. What You Say: Before the Activity: Let s practice our memory verse for this month: I bring you good news of great joy, Luke 2:10. Nice job! During the Activity: Let s be like the angels in the story today! We can pretend to tell the Shepherds the GREAT NEWS! Are you ready? First, let s say it very softly. (Say the verse softly.) Awesome! Now let s say it loudly! (Say the verse loudly.) Great job! I bet you can say it even LOUDER! (Say the verse very loudly.) That was awesome! After the Activity: It s so much fun telling people about the greatest gift: JESUS! I bet the angels were so excited to tell the shepherds that Jesus was born. Why is Jesus special? [Bottom Line] Jesus is God s Son! 2011 Orange. All rights reserved. 19
